Who owns MCI Group?
Roger Tondeur founded MCI in Geneva in 1987. In 2010, he handed over the reins to his son, Sébastien Tondeur, who now leads the company as CEO.

Is Verizon a MCI?
Known as MCI at the time of the merger, WorldCom’s network assets are now part of Verizon Enterprise Solutions. WorldCom was originally founded in 1983 as Long Distance Discount Service, Inc. WorldCom would emerge from bankruptcy in 2004, rebranding itself as MCI, before being bought by Verizon.

Why did MCI WorldCom fail?
WorldCom was a telecommunications company that went bankrupt in 2002 following a massive accounting fraud.
